Court Day May the1st.1739 Continued

Freemen{

Moreton

Thomas Moreton< no role > a Carpenter by Trade was now by Virtue of an Order of the
Court of Aldermen and Testimony of Richard Carter< no role > Citizen and Wax Chandler
made Free

Hoff

John Hoff< no role > of Greek Street near Soho Square who was bound to William
Abbott
< no role > deceased was now by testimoney of William Abbott< no role > his son and
Executor made Free

Haynes to Allen

Consented That Daniel Haynes< no role > the late Apprentice of George Toe< no role > Citizen
and Carpenter of London be Assigned to Joseph Allen< no role > Citizen and Carpenter
of London (having Sued out his Indentures)for the Remainder of his Apprenticeship

Ordered That Thomas Smith< no role > against whom an Action is brought in the
Mayors Court for Working as a Carpenter in the Freedom(he notheing Free)
be Prosecuted with the atmost expedition unless he pays the full Penalty &
Costs
